Experience one of Utah’s most otherworldly trail races: Goblin Valley Trail Runs, hosted by Elevation Culture in the surreal landscape of Goblin Valley State Park, near Green River, UT. Against towering hoodoo formations and desert vistas, this event features a Trail Half Marathon, Full Marathon, 10K, 5K, youth mile, and relay options across a festive weekend.
🏃 Race Experience & Terrain
The Half Marathon begins at 7:00 AM MST, followed immediately by the Marathon start and relay teams. Both share flowing single-track loops that capture panoramic views of the goblin-like rock pinnacles. The 10K (8:00 AM) and 5K courses offer lollipop or out-and-back routes to explore sandy desert washes and trail textures. Aid stations include GU products, fruit, electrolyte drink, and varied snacks—including wraps and avocados—all served in a cup-less, eco-conscious format.
🎯 Unique Appeal
This boutique desert trail race caps entries to maintain serenity on the hoodoos and minimize ecological impact. Its remote setting, sustainable practices, and handcrafted wooden awards reflect an event built for scenery and community rather than size. All finishers receive soft tri-blend shirts, custom medals, and reusable cups. Post-race festival activities—music, elevated camps, recovery stations, and chili—mirror the event’s playful, desert‑festival character.
